A protected desert valley in southern Jordan characterised by massive sandstone and granite formations rising from a flat red-sand floor, some reaching 1,700 metres in elevation. The interplay of rock colour — deep burgundy, ochre, and rose — shifts dramatically through the day, with pre-dawn blue light and the minutes around sunrise and sunset offering the most intense photographic conditions. The area was used as a base by T.E. Lawrence during the Arab Revolt and has served as a stand-in for Mars in multiple film productions. Overnight camps beneath the open sky allow observation of exceptional star density.
